区块链钱包是用于存储、管理和交易加密数字资产的工具。与传统的钱包相比,区块链钱包提供了更高的安全性和透明度,其核心在于去中心化的区块链技术。用户可以通过这些钱包进行加密货币的发送和接收,查看交易记录,并管理其资产。然而,在设计和开发一个有效的区块链钱包时,涉及的成本并不是一个简单的数字。这需要对多个因素进行全面的评估与分析。
开发一个区块链钱包的费用通常由以下几个核心部分组成:
技术开发是区块链钱包开发中最大的开支之一,主要包括后端和前端开发费用。后端开发涉及区块链集成、智能合约编写、API开发等;而前端开发则涉及用户界面的设计和实现。根据开发团队的技术能力和项目需求,该部分成本可能会相差甚远。
用户体验设计(UX/UI设计)对应用的成功至关重要。一个直观且吸引用户的界面不仅可以提升用户满意度,还可以提高用户留存率。在这一阶段,设计师需要创建原型和进行用户测试,确保产品友好易用,这个过程也需要一定的资金投入。
由于加密资产的特性,安全性在钱包应用开发中至关重要。开发者必须实施多种安全措施,如加密存储、两步验证等,以保护用户资金。此外,各国对于区块链技术的监管和合规要求不同,因此在开发过程中可能还需投入额外资源进行法律咨询和合规化设计。
开发完成后,钱包的功能和安全性需要经过严格的测试。测试包括单元测试、集成测试和用户验收测试等,这一过程会涉及到额外的工程时间和成本。此外,钱包上线后,还需定期维护和升级,这是持续的费用支出。
在考虑了各个组成部分后,我们可以通过一些示例来更具体地了解开发一个区块链钱包可能涉及的费用范围。根据市场调查,开发一个功能相对简单的区块链钱包,大致费用可以在5,000到15,000美元之间。而一个拥有复杂功能和高级安全措施的钱包,费用可能会高达到100,000美元以上。
这种类型的区块链钱包通常只包含基本功能,如发送和接收交易、查看余额等。开发团队规模相对较小,可能只需要几周的时间来完成。总体费用可能在5,000美元到15,000美元之间。
中等级钱包进一步增加了用户体验和功能,如多币种支持、简单的市场分析工具等。这类项目通常需要大约几个月的开发时间,费用范围在30,000美元到70,000美元。
如果你的项目希望包含如去中心化交易所集成、复杂的智能合约功能和顶级安全防护,这将需要更大规模的开发团队,通常需耗时6个月到一年不等。总费用可能高达100,000美元或更多。
除了上述基础的估算外,还有许多其他因素可能会影响整体的开发费用。
开发团队的地理位置对于费用有显著影响。在北美、英国等地区,开发者的薪资普遍较高;而在东欧、亚太等地,开发费用可能相对较低。因此,选择合适的开发团队可以减少成本支出。
项目的功能越复杂,所需的开发时间与人力成本就会越高。时限要求也会对费用产生影响,比较紧迫的项目可能需要额外的资源投入。
开发团队在设计初期需考虑该钱包的可扩展性和未来发展。如果希望后续可以增加更多功能,那么初期设计费用可能会增加,但长期来看,它将为后续的功能添加提供便利。
通过选择合适的策略和方法,有效降低区块链钱包开发的费用是可行的,以下是一些实用建议:
通过开发一个最小可行产品,可以在较低成本的情况下测试市场反应。这允许开发团队在用户反馈的基础上逐步增加功能,从而避免一次性投入过高。
利用现有的区块链解决方案和开源软件,可以在减少开发时间和成本的同时保证产品的功能性与安全性。例如,许多公司已经开发出了成熟的区块链开发框架,能够直接使用。
随着远程工作的普及,许多开发者能够在全球范围内进行合作,选择成本相对低的开发团队,有助于显著降低费用。
开发一个区块链钱包应用的费用不仅受技术、设计等多方面因素的影响,还与市场需求、开发团队的选择紧密相关。通过全面的分析和合理的规划,可以找到适合自身项目的预算方案。在未来不断发展的区块链领域中,把握潮流并投入合适的资源,才能取得更大的成功和更好的用户反馈。
不断变化的技术和市场环境意味着,持续审视钱包的功能和安全性必不可少,才能为用户提供更好的服务。希望本篇文章能为你开发区块链钱包的决策提供有价值的参考。